Sdílet prostřednictvím


ODataCollectionSerializer Třída

Definice

ODataSerializer pro serializaci kolekce primitivních nebo výčtových typů.

public class ODataCollectionSerializer : Microsoft.AspNet.OData.Formatter.Serialization.ODataEdmTypeSerializer
type ODataCollectionSerializer = class
    inherit ODataEdmTypeSerializer
Public Class ODataCollectionSerializer
Inherits ODataEdmTypeSerializer
Dědičnost
ODataCollectionSerializer

Konstruktory

ODataCollectionSerializer(ODataSerializerProvider, Boolean)

Inicializuje novou instanci ODataCollectionSerializer třídy .

ODataCollectionSerializer(ODataSerializerProvider)

Inicializuje novou instanci ODataCollectionSerializer třídy .

Vlastnosti

ODataPayloadKind

Získá, ODataPayloadKind že tento serializátor generuje.

(Zděděno od ODataSerializer)
SerializerProvider

Získá, ODataSerializerProvider který lze použít k zápisu vnitřní objekty.

(Zděděno od ODataEdmTypeSerializer)

Metody

AddTypeNameAnnotationAsNeeded(ODataCollectionValue, ODataMetadataLevel)

Přidá poznámky k názvu typu vyžadované pro správnou serializaci světla JSON.

CreateODataCollectionValue(IEnumerable, IEdmTypeReference, ODataSerializerContext)

Vytvoří pro ODataCollectionValue výčet reprezentovaný objektem enumerable.

CreateODataValue(Object, IEdmTypeReference, ODataSerializerContext)

Vytvoří objekt ODataValue pro objekt reprezentovaný objektem graph.

WriteCollection(ODataCollectionWriter, Object, IEdmTypeReference, ODataSerializerContext)

Zapíše danou graph metodu pomocí daného writer.

WriteCollectionAsync(ODataCollectionWriter, Object, IEdmTypeReference, ODataSerializerContext)

Zapíše danou graph metodu pomocí daného writer.

WriteObject(Object, Type, ODataMessageWriter, ODataSerializerContext)

Zapíše daný objekt určený grafem parametrů jako celek pomocí daného messageWriter a writeContext.

WriteObjectAsync(Object, Type, ODataMessageWriter, ODataSerializerContext)

Zapíše daný objekt určený grafem parametrů jako celek pomocí daného messageWriter a writeContext.

WriteObjectInline(Object, IEdmTypeReference, ODataWriter, ODataSerializerContext)

Zapíše daný objekt určený grafem parametrů jako součást existující zprávy OData pomocí daného messageWriter a writeContext.

(Zděděno od ODataEdmTypeSerializer)
WriteObjectInlineAsync(Object, IEdmTypeReference, ODataWriter, ODataSerializerContext)

Zapíše daný objekt určený grafem parametrů jako součást existující zprávy OData pomocí daného messageWriter a writeContext.

(Zděděno od ODataEdmTypeSerializer)

Platí pro